I think its unfair Stanway is getting this constant rap for his performnces. His goalkeeping stats are up there with others. It was the collective defensive unit as a team that let us down. You only have to watch game highlights to see the same defensive lapses game after game, not closing down, not tracking, terrible marking, weak trailing leg challenges, lack of tackles higher up the pitch. He faced more shots across the season than any other keeper in the league and his overall save rate was decent.

Murray has inherited a poor squad, he will heed to strengthen in every key outfield area
